static LotoWynik() { if (WynikLotoWzór == null) { WynikLotoWzór = MałeUproszczenia.WczytajXML <LinikaWzgledna>("Loto\\Liniki\\WynikLoto.linika"); WynikLotoWzór.PrzygotujSzablon(); } }
public InteligentneRozpoznawanieWzorca(LinikaWzgledna linikaWzgledna, LinikaWzgledna lk, ObszarWzgledny[] tb, int v) { linikaWzgledna.PrzygotujSzablon(); this.Szablon = linikaWzgledna; this.Linika = lk; this.NajlepszyKomplet = tb; this.MaksymalnyDystans = v; OdległośćDlaNiepoprawnych = MaksymalnyDystans + ObszarWzgledny.SkalerIlorazuOdległościDoBrakuPodobieństwaZeWzorcem * 20; IlośćWarstw = Szablon.CześciLinijek.Count; DłógośćLiniki = lk.CześciLinijek.Count; UsuńNakładająceSię(); SprawdźBlokadeIWyznaczDystans(); Wczytaj(); TabelaBlokad = new float[IlośćWarstw, DłógośćLiniki]; }